Output bbebbc7152778aaf132b769594f0d74d2768adc6d8abe991e90e94585be31283:56

value
32836975
script pubkey
OP_0 OP_PUSHBYTES_20 08faf944736908cba0d2394e99a6d3556dcdad2b
address
bc1qpra0j3rndyyvhgxj898fnfkn24kumtftyzap50
transaction
bbebbc7152778aaf132b769594f0d74d2768adc6d8abe991e90e94585be31283
confirmations
239560
spent
true